disband    音標拼音: [dɪsb'ænd]
vt. 解散,使退伍
vi. 解散

解散,使退伍解散

disband
v 1: cause to break up or cease to function; "the principal
disbanded the political student organization"
2: stop functioning or cohering as a unit; "The political wing
of the party dissolved after much internal fighting" [synonym:
{disband}, {dissolve}]

Disband \Dis*band"\ (?; see {Dis-}), v. t. [imp. & p. p.
{Disbanded}; p. pr. & vb. n. {Disbanding}.] [Pref. dis-
band: cf. OF. desbander, F. d['e]bander, to unbind, unbend.
See {Band}, and cf. {Disbend}, {Disbind}.]
1. To loose the bands of; to set free; to disunite; to
scatter; to disperse; to break up the organization of;
especially, to dismiss from military service; as, to
disband an army.
[1913 Webster]

They disbanded themselves and returned, every man to
his own dwelling. --Knolles.
[1913 Webster]

2. To divorce. [Obs.]
[1913 Webster]

And therefore . . . she ought to be disbanded.
--Milton.
[1913 Webster]


Disband \Dis*band"\, v. i.
To become separated, broken up, dissolved, or scattered;
especially, to quit military service by breaking up
organization.
[1913 Webster]

When both rocks and all things shall disband.
--Herbert.
[1913 Webster]

Human society would in a short space disband.
--Tillotson.
[1913 Webster]
